has gloss | eng: Annyalla or Annayalla is a small village and townland situated in the east of County Monaghan in Ireland between Castleblayney and Clontibret. Annyalla is also the name of an area of County Monaghan and is part of the parish of Clontibret. The main feature of the village is St Michael's church, built between 1922 and 1927. The Irish or Gaelic name for the place is Eanaigh Gheala which means "the bright marshes". |
